UFI is the association of the world's leading tradeshow organisers and fairground owners, as well as the major national and international exhibition associations, and selected partners of the exhibition industry.
"Expo Centre Sharjah is now the member of a privileged forum for dialogue. This will help us enhance our global standing and reinforce the position of the UAE and Sharjah on the international exhibitions map,"
said Mr Saif Mohammed Al Midfa, Director-General of Expo Centre Sharjah.
"With this membership, Expo Centre Sharjah also stands to gain from the support extended by UFI to its members. UFI will be representing and promoting its members and the exhibition industry worldwide," said Mr Midfa.
UFI has 533 full members, including 276 exhibition organisers, 58 hall owner managers, 124 exhibition organisers and hall owner managers, and 46 associations.
"Another advantage is the 'UFI approved event'. There is an opportunity to undergo audit and obtain the 'UFI approved event' tag for our shows, which will assure exhibitors and visitors alike that they will benefit from a professionally planned and managed concept.
The 'UFI approved event' tag is a proof of high quality," said Mr Midfa.
A UFI approved event is considered to have proven its quality and that of its related services. The UFI logo is used to identify a UFI approved event.
UFI also plays the role of an efficient networking platform where professionals of the exhibition industry can exchange ideas and experiences. Members are also provided with valuable studies and
research regarding all aspects of the exhibition industry. "Educational training opportunities are also available to members, the prominent among them being the Exhibition Management Degree," said Mr Midfa.
In association with the University of Cooperative Education in Ravensburg, Germany, UFI is offering the Exhibition Management Degree (EMD) to train exhibition industry professionals to meet event management demands of the future.
